"Supermodel Snatch Game" is the fifth episode of the eighth season of the American television series RuPaul's Drag Race.[1][2][3] Gigi Hadid and Chanel Iman make guest appearances.

For the main challenge, the contestants play the Snatch Game. Gigi Hadid and Chanel Iman star as the celebrity guests. Following are the contestants and impersonated celebrities:

The runway category is "Night of a Thousand Madonna's". Thorgy Thor, Derrick Barry, and Naomi Smalls present kimono looks based on the "Nothing Really Matters" music video, while Kim Chi does another kimono based on the "Paradise (Not for Me)" music video. Acid Betty's look is based on the "Bedtime Story" music video, Robbie Turner's on A League of Their Own, Chi Chi DeVayne on the Blond Ambition Tour, and Bob the Drag Queen on Madonna's 2013 GLAAD Media Awards red carpet look.[4][5]

Bob the Drag Queen, Derrick Barry, and Thorgy Thor receive positive critiques, and Bob the Drag Queen wins the challenge. Acid Betty, Naomi Smalls, and Robbie Turner receive negative critiques, and Robbie Turner is deemed safe. Acid Betty and Naomi Smalls face off in a lip-sync content to "Causing a Commotion" by Madonna. Naomi Smalls wins the lip-sync and Acid Betty is eliminated from the competition.

The number of kimonos shown is referenced in season 9's Snatch Game where the runway category is the same, with RuPaul calling it "KimoNo She Betta Don't!"
